Fire Red Shrimp (also called High Grade Cherry Shrimp) sit at the top of the Neocaridina davidi red color grading scale. Unlike standard Cherry shrimp, which have transparent areas on the legs and underside, Fire Reds display fully opaque, solid red coloration across the entire body. Same beginner-friendly care, dramatically better color.

Care Notes

Neocaridina are forgiving, but stability matters more than perfection. Avoid sudden swings in temperature, pH, or GH — drip acclimation on arrival is essential. Do not use copper-based medications in a shrimp tank under any circumstances. Feed a small amount 3–4 times per week; remove uneaten food after 24 hours. A mature tank with established biofilm is the best environment for a new colony.

Expert Advice
Razz Aquatics Recommendation

Fire Red Shrimp show their color best against dark substrate. Black sand or fine gravel makes the solid red pop immediately. Java Moss or Weeping Moss gives shrimplets hiding spots and the shrimp constant biofilm grazing surfaces. A sponge filter is the recommended filtration.

What makes Fire Red different from Cherry Shrimp?+
Fire Red shrimp are a high-grade Cherry shrimp color variant — selectively bred for fully opaque, solid red pigmentation. Standard Cherry shrimp have transparent areas on the legs and underside. Fire Red shrimp have the same care requirements but significantly more intense coloration.
What water parameters do Fire Red Shrimp need?+
pH 6.5–8.0, temperature 65–80°F, GH 6–8, KH 2–4. Most conditioned tap water works well. Avoid copper-based medications and sudden parameter swings.

Can Fire Red Shrimp live with fish?+
Yes, with the right species. Ember Tetras, Pygmy Corydoras, Otocinclus, and Celestial Pearl Danios are safe choices. Avoid any fish large enough to swallow a shrimp.
